Curso PHP5 - Unidad 1

3
Unidad 1: Introducción al lenguaje PHP 5 1. ¿Qué es PHP? PHP (acrónimo recursivo de "PHP: Hypertext Preprocessor") es un lenguaje de programación interpretado. Las siglas PHP provienen de Personal Home Page, que podemos traducir como Procesador personal de páginas web o de Hipertexto. 2. ¿Cómo funciona PHP? El código en PHP incluido en una página html se ejecuta en el servidor antes de que se envíe la página al usuario que lo pida. Para hacer esto es necesario que en el servidor se instale las extensiones necesarias de PHP. 3. ¿Qué diferencia hay entre ASP y PHP? Desde el punto de vista del funcionamiento, ninguna. Ambos son lenguajes que procesan las páginas html que contienen un código de programación específico en cada caso. 4. ¿Cuánto cuesta PHP? PHP es gratuito. Cualquiera lo puede usar ya que es de libre distribución. 5. ¿Como se incluye el código PHP en una página html? Es suficiente introducir el código de la página entre los tag: "<?" y "?>". El código será ejecutado por el servidor cuando un visitante solicita esta página. 6. ¿Cómo puedo saber si mi servidor personal de Internet soporta el lenguaje PHP? Basta con crear un archivo que contenga la línea: <? phpinfo(); ?> Cargando la página con el propio navegador se debe mostrar una serie de informaciones sobre PHP. Si no es así, significa que PHP no está disponible en el servidor.

description

Primera parte del Curso de PHP5

Transcript of Curso PHP5 - Unidad 1

Page 1: Curso PHP5 - Unidad 1

Unidad 1: Introducción al lenguaje PHP 5 1. ¿Qué es PHP? PHP (acrónimo recursivo de "PHP: Hypertext Preprocessor") es un lenguaje de programación interpretado. Las siglas PHP provienen de Personal Home Page, que podemos traducir como Procesador personal de páginas web o de Hipertexto. 2. ¿Cómo funciona PHP? El código en PHP incluido en una página html se ejecuta en el servidor antes de que se envíe la página al usuario que lo pida. Para hacer esto es necesario que en el servidor se instale las extensiones necesarias de PHP. 3. ¿Qué diferencia hay entre ASP y PHP? Desde el punto de vista del funcionamiento, ninguna. Ambos son lenguajes que procesan las páginas html que contienen un código de programación específico en cada caso. 4. ¿Cuánto cuesta PHP? PHP es gratuito. Cualquiera lo puede usar ya que es de libre distribución. 5. ¿Como se incluye el código PHP en una página html? Es suficiente introducir el código de la página entre los tag: "<?" y "?>". El código será ejecutado por el servidor cuando un visitante solicita esta página. 6. ¿Cómo puedo saber si mi servidor personal de Internet soporta el lenguaje PHP? Basta con crear un archivo que contenga la línea: <? phpinfo(); ?> Cargando la página con el propio navegador se debe mostrar una serie de informaciones sobre PHP. Si no es así, significa que PHP no está disponible en el servidor.

Page 2: Curso PHP5 - Unidad 1

7. ¿Cómo se cambia la configuración de PHP? Todas las opciones de PHP se pueden establecer a través del archivo "PHP.ini". En el Curso Avanzado de PHP de Mentor se trata en profundidad este tema. 8. ¿Cómo se pueden conocer el tipo de navegador y otras informaciones sobre los visitantes a mi sitio? Con las variables de sistema puestas a disposición por PHP, que se pueden ver con la instrucción: "phpinfo();" 9. Al ejecutar el script me aparece el siguiente error: Parse error: syntax error, unexpected T_ECHO, expecting ',' or ';' ¿Cuál es el problema? Recuerda que todas las sentencia de PHP deben acabar con “;”. 10. ¿Cómo se definen la variables en PHP? Los nombres de las variables y matrices deben iniciarse siempre con el signo $. Deben ser correctos y conviene que sean fáciles de manejar y que tengan algún significado que informe de su contenido. 11. ¿Qué diferencia hay entre usar comillas simples o dobles dentro de un echo? En PHP no hay diferencia entre usar unas u otras, siempre y cuando empieces y acabes con el mismo tipo, claro. 12. ¿Qué función de PHP puedo utilizar para mostrar en el navegador un número formateado con dos decimales? Prueba a escribir el siguiente código: printf("%0.2f", $la_cantidad); 13. ¿Los operadores se ejecutan de izquierda a derecha en el orden en que están escritos? No. Los operadores siguen una prelación u orden jerárquico que debemos tener en cuenta. Los paréntesis sirven para determinar el orden de ejecución de los operadores sin tener en cuenta la precedencia de los mismos.

Page 3: Curso PHP5 - Unidad 1

14. ¿Qué significa indentar el código fuente? Para poder seguir mejor el flujo de un programa y ver más intuitivamente su código, conviene siempre indentar (adentrar unos espacios) las sentencias que están incluidas dentro de una estructura.